Siracusaville, Louisiana

Siracusaville is a census-designated place (CDP) in St. Mary Parish, Louisiana, United States. As of the 2020 census, Siracusaville had a population of 297. It is part of the Morgan City Micropolitan Statistical Area.

Geography

Siracusaville is located at (29.68715, -91.14186), adjacent to the eastern border of Morgan City. Louisiana State Route 182 is an east-west road that passes through the southern part of the community, along the edge of Bayou Boeuf, part of the Intracoastal Waterway. U.S. Route 90, a four-lane expressway, forms the northeastern border of the CDP but provides no direct access to it; the closest exits are Exit 176 in Morgan City to the west and Exit 181 in Amelia to the east.

Demographics

Siracusaville first appeared as a census designated place in the 2010 U.S. census.
